I stabbed my boyfriend, Woman tells court
Woman - 21, Pleads guilty of Stabbing Boyfriend
She committed the offence following a quarrel over quitting their relationship
The man died after bleeding excessively from the neck

21-year-old woman wants a Nakuru Court to allow her
plead guilty to killing her boyfriend on condition that she is granted a plea
bargain agreement.

The youthful woman, Branswet Wambui admitted that she
had stabbed John Mwago using a kitchen knife on the night of October 21, 2020
at Bismarck area in Nakuru County following an altercation.
Wambui told Justice Hillary Chemitei that the entire
facts of the case that were presented before him by Prosecution counsel
Vena Odero were true and that she was guilty as charged.
The Judge said after Wambui presented her prayers to
the Court: “The accused person has pleaded guilty to the lesser charge of
manslaughter (killing without malice nor intention) and a plea of being guilty
is entered.”
According to Prosecution, on the fateful night, at
around 11.30 pm, Wambui had screamed, calling for help from neighbors to rescue
her fiancé after she stabbed him.
“The accused person told her neighbour identified as
Hellen Nyambura that she and her fiancé Mwago had picked a bitter quarrel after
she (Wambui) threatened to call off their relationship,” Odero told the court.
According to a post
mortem report that was filed in court, Mwago died as a result of excessive
bleeding from the neck.
“I was not intimidated; neither was I threatened to
admit to the charge of manslaughter but it was unintentional,” she pleaded.
The woman who was arrested the same night of the incident has been out on a bond of Sh800,000 and she is expected to mitigate her case before sentencing on November 15, 2021.
